Arturo Vidal ‘agrees with Jurgen Klopp’ that this Champions League clash with Liverpool is the kind of game the Inter midfielder lives for.

The first leg of this Champions League Round of 16 tie kicks off at San Siro at 20.00 GMT.

Vidal starts in midfield, as Nicolò Barella is out for both legs due to suspension, but Liverpool manager Klopp said this was just the kind of game where the experienced Chilean can shine.

“I agree with Jurgen Klopp,” grinned Vidal on Amazon Prime Italia.

“He is one of the best coaches in the world, he knows about football and how my career developed.

“It’s true that I have played many Champions League games at the top level, now I am here with Inter and it’s the most important game in the two years I have been here.”

Liverpool won all six of their Champions League group games, so do the Reds have any weaknesses?

“We hope so! We know that we need the perfect performance to get a good result and set up a strong second leg.”
